Centaurus is a multi-use development project presently under construction in Islamabad’s arterial corridor called as Blue Area. It is a project of PGCL (Pak Gulf Company Limited). It is the joint gamble of two builder companies namely Al-Tamimi (Kingdom of Saudi Arabia) and Sardar Builders (Pakistan) and involves an area of 6.59 acres of land. PGCL is a prominent real estate firm who has completed many mega projects in the past. Centaurus incorporates the following major four divisions namely.

  • Shopping mall
  • Residential blocks
  • Corporate complex

And the most prominent of all, a 7-star hotel.

The mammoth mall at Centaurus will offer a monster of architectural anticipation. Some of its key features include 5 air conditioned floors, attractive water features, escalators, capsule lifts, cinemas, flexible floor sizing, basement car parking, prayer area and much more.

The two Residential blocks will recommend an outstanding living for the entire family. Discrete architecture respires life to a lifestyle of ease which mainly includes 22 levels of lavishness, swimming pools, gyms, indoor games area, multimedia rooms and etc. As for the Corporate complex, it will offer a great infrastructure for commerce from around the world. Key features include 22 executive floors, stretchy floors sizing and plans, central air conditioning, basement parking lots and much more.

The 7-star hotel offers a matchless soothe in a sophisticated style. It includes 350 suites filled with luxury, a dramatic central atrium, individual butler service, 24 hours services, grand ballroom and much more.

The foremost benefit of this project is that a whole new source of employment will emerge in the capital of Pakistan and will help in nourishing its economy. But besides the charm of this great project there are few things which cannot be ignored. First we have the issue of local security (remember ‘Mariott’ anyone?) and then a little concern over its location as most of the people believe that construction of such huge buildings in Pakistan will result in more pollution and congestion.
